I have a team of 4 people, working alongside it's sister company who have just had to restructure, with 25% of their staff being lost and the remainder on a 20% reduction in hours.

We are a very seperate company to them and so far haven't had to make any cutbacks.....however, the time is dawning on us.

The other company followed all correct procedures ie, consultation with all the staff over the correct period, as is set out by their volume of staff (30).

If things don't improve, I could be looking at having to make cuts and think I can get away with a 20% reduction in hours/salary rather than letting anyone go. I have discussed my fears with my team, however, haven't given them any formal notice as yet.

Do I have to go through consultation if they are in agreement with the reduction? Also will I have to change their current contracts as it clearly states the working hours?
